Quick Question Bout Balancer Pulley

what is a good way to stop the crank from moving when removing the harmonic balancer? so that when u try to losen the bolts the crank dont spin

If you use a breaker bar or something long for leverage and a 6 point socket, you can usually give it a "pop" quickly and they will break loose. If not, slip something through the spokes of the pulley and let it spin until it safely wedges against something.
You could also try a "strap wrench".

I just used an impact with the correct socket, so it would only turn the bolts, came off really easy.
